Hi, I know this might be super rare, but in the potential case that someone suspects they were given an incorrect study score by VCAA, how would they go about this? Assuming VCAA is capable of making mistakes??

When you get the letter from VCAA on Wednesday, you can apply to have your statement of marks sent to you. That tells you what mark you scored for each question. After that you can apply to have your exam script remarked and re-looked at if you believe that there's a mistake. It definitely does happen, as I know someone who got their methods score upgraded due to a mistake in multi-choice marking.

So if we want to have an inspection of our exam, do we have to order a statement of marks along with it?
Yep, there's no marks or answers on the copy of your exam you see when inspecting it so you need the statement.
